Discover Milhars, the "village of walls"
Located at the meeting point of Quercy, Rouergue, and Albigeois, this picturesque small town, nestled between Cordes-sur-Ciel, St-Antonin-Noble-Val, and Najac, is the ideal destination for exploring the Tarn and the Bastides.
A medieval village at the entrance to the Cérou and Bonnan valleys, Milhars is arranged in a spiral around a feudal castle restored in 1630. Its many renovated walls have earned it the nickname "village of walls." Tranquility and quality of life are its main assets.
